Interim Rangers head coach Barry Ferguson has named his team to face Dundee in the Scottish Premiership this evening - and there's a notable absence. 

The Ibrox club heads to the north-east as they make their return to action after the international break. 

Last time out, Rangers came away from Parkhead triumphant after a 3-2 victory over city rivals Celtic.

Nicolas Raskin, Mohamed Diomande and Hamza Igamane all scored on that day as Ferguson led his team to a memorable win. 

Glasgow's east end wasn't a happy hunting ground for Rangers before a fortnight ago. Similarly, Dens Park has proved a tricky venue for the Govan side of late. 

Rangers have dropped points upon their last two trips to face Dundee, but will look to change that today. 

From his side's 3-2 win over Celtic last time out, Ferguson has made one alteration for tonight's match as Igamane replaces the injured Vaclav Cerny.

Confirmed Rangers XI to face Dundee: Butland, Tavernier, Souttar, Balogun, Ridvan, Sterling, Raskin, Barron, Diomande, Igamane, Dessers.

Substitutes: Kelly, Propper, Cortes, Lawrence, Bajrami, Jefte, Hagi, Rice, Danilo.

Dundee starting XI: Carson, Shaughnessey, McGhee, Tiffoney, Mulligan, Adewumi, Murray, F. Robertson, Larkeche, Sylla, Donnelly. 

Substitutes: McCracken, Sharp, Astley, Reilly, Samuels, Koumetio, Ingram, Garza, Lopez.
